Recognize These Symptoms? It Could Be Vein Disease.

While each individual's experience with vein disease may vary, they commonly share one condition: chronic venous insufficiency (CVI). CVI occurs when your leg veins don’t allow blood to flow back up to your heart. The result is symptoms such as leg pain, varicose veins, spider veins, restless legs, cramps, skin changes, leg and foot swelling, leg ulcers, blood clots, and other leg discomfort.

What are varicose veins?

Because they can cause pain and discomfort on almost any part of the leg, varicose veins can be debilitating if not properly treated.

Symptoms of varicose veins include:
• Leg pain, aching, or cramping
• Fatigued or heavy-feeling legs
• Itching and burning
• Swollen ankles and feet
• Restless legs
• Leg ulcers
• Deep vein thrombosis (DVT)

What are spider veins?

Seeing tiny red, blue, or purple blood vessels that look like a spider web just below the skin of your legs? These could be spider veins. Caused by damaged blood vessels, spider veins are especially bothersome after standing for long periods of time.

Symptoms of spider veins include:
Itching, aching, or burning
• Unsightly appearance
• Leg soreness
• Skin discoloration around visible veins

What is deep vein thrombosis (DVT)?

DVT is a serious condition characterized by a blood clot in a deep vein, typically in the legs, thighs, or pelvis. It's important to recognize the signs and symptoms of DVT, such as leg pain, swelling, warm, red, or discolored skin. If you suspect DVT, seek medical attention immediately.

What is peripheral artery disease (PAD)?

PAD can cause symptoms such as leg pain, numbness, and weakness. If you're experiencing any of these symptoms, it's essential to consult with a PAD doctor for a comprehensive evaluation and personalized treatment plan.

What is restless leg syndrome (RLS)?

RLS causes an uncontrollable urge to move the legs, usually due to discomfort or unpleasant leg sensations. Symptoms typically worsen during periods of inactivity or rest and can negatively impact sleep quality. Our team offers effective treatment options to improve your quality of life.

What causes swollen legs and feet?

Various factors, including chronic venous insufficiency, a blood clot in the leg, or heart-related issues, can lead to an abnormal fluid buildup in the body, a condition known as edema. It's important to seek medical advice to determine the cause of the swelling and receive appropriate treatment.
